Spells don't follow crafting limitations as far as I know.
GMW should work just fine. But there are a couple major drawbacks to your strategy. First and foremost is that your weapon is very vulnerable to dispel magic. Any area dispel will hit your weapon as well as you. As this should be a frequent tactic of enemies at your level, its a big thing to consider.
It is NOT a crafting limitation: "A single weapon cannot have a modified bonus (enhancement bonus plus special ability bonus equivalent) higher than +10." There is no mention of crafting anywhere in that sentence. It is clearly spelled out that a single weapon cannot be higher than +10.
With that said, it honestly isn't going to come up a whole lot, except maybe in very high-level games. If your PC has a +5 vorpal sword (+10 modified) and somebody casts a +5 GMW on it, it is still a +5 vorpal sword (since only the highest enhancement bonus applies, and they do not stack).
